Healthcare in Australia For Working Holiday Makers
Working Holiday Makers are generally not covered by Medicare - the public healthcare system in Australia - or entitled to Australian social security benefits. It is therefore essential to have adequate insurance and sufficient funds to support yourself during your stay in Australia.
Medical treatment in Australia can be very expensive and it is advisable to have both travel and health insurance, unless there is a reciprocal health agreement between Australia and your country of citizenship.
Enquiries about healthcare arrangements in Australia should be directed to your nearest Australian diplomatic office when you apply.
